Ndume Hosts EU Ambassador, Seeks More Support In Health, Education

The Senator representing Borno South, Sen. Mohammed Ali Ndume has hosted the European Union Delegation Ambassador to Nigeria, Samuela Isopi.

The senator while appreciating the ambassador for her visit, sought more support in the health and education sector. 

He noted that the areas were the worst hit by the Boko Haram insurgency in Borno state especially the Gwoza local government area of the state. 

He noted that the insurgents had declared the LGA their headquarters at the height of their activities in the past years. 

He stressed the need for improved funding for the health sector to respond to the numerous challenges faced by the LGA. 

Ndume said the only hospital in the LGA has been overstretched as a result of the town's population and lack of equipment in addition to the shortage of medical personnel. 

The Senator further applauded the United Nations for its effort in building 500 housing units in the LGA while calling on the EU to follow suit. 

Earlier in her remarks, the ambassador who was accompanied by the Political Adviser, Press and Information to the EU Delegation, Osaro Odemwinge said her visit was to discuss issues of insecurity, humanitarian services and the forthcoming 2023 elections.

Isopi highlighted some of the working relationships between the Union and some Nigerian Government Agencies like the INEC, the Humanitarian Ministry as well as interventions in crisis-prone areas.

She explained that she was in Borno State in July 2022 where she met the State Governor, Babagana Umara Zulum and the Commander of Operation Lafia Dole and undertook an assessment visit to Bama.

Reacting to the senator's request, she appreciated him while promising to treat the request as a priority.
